| 种属 | 大鼠 |
| 组织来源 | 正常腿部肌肉组织 |
| 传代比例 | 1:2传代 |
| 完全培养基配置 | 基础培养基500ml ;生长添加剂5ml ;胎牛血清10ml ;双抗5ml |
| 简介 | 肌肉可分为肌腹和肌腱 ,其中两端较细呈乳白色的部分为肌腱 ,呈索条或扁带状 ,由平行的胶原纤维束构成 ,色白 , 有光泽 ,但无收缩能力 ,腱附着于骨处与骨膜牢固地编织在一起 ,属于结缔组织 ,同时 ,肌腹的表面包以结缔组织性 外膜 ,向两端则与肌腱组织融合在一起 ,这些结缔组织是由成纤维细胞构成 ,具有支持、连接、保护和营养功能。 |
| 形态 | 长梭状细胞样 ,不规则细胞样 |
| 生长特征 | 贴壁生长 |
| 细胞检测 | 波形蛋白( Vimentin )免疫荧光染色为阳性免疫荧光鉴定 ,细胞纯度可达90%以上 ,不含有HIV-1、HBV、HCV、 支原体、细菌、酵母和真菌等。 |

While intracardiac injections are most commonly used for studies of bone metastasis, in certain instances intratibial or mammary fat pad injections are more appropriate. Intracardiac injections are typically performed when using human tumor cells with the goal of monitoring later stages of metastasis, specifically the ability of cancer cells to arrest in bone, survive, proliferate, and establish tumors that develop into cancer-induced bone disease. Intratibial injections are performed if focusing on the relationship of cancer cells and bone after a tumor has metastasized to bone, which correlates roughly to established metastatic bone disease. Neither of these models recapitulates early steps in the metastatic process prior to embolism and entry of tumor cells into the circulation. If monitoring primary tumor growth or metastasis from the primary site to bone, then mammary fat pad inoculations are usually preferred; however, very few tumor cell lines will consistently metastasize to bone from the primary site, with 4T1 bone-preferential clones, a mouse mammary carcinoma, being the exception. This manuscript details inoculation procedures and highlights key steps in post inoculation analyses. Specifically, it includes cell culture, tumor cell inoculation procedures for intracardiac and intratibial inoculations, as well as brief information regarding weekly monitoring by x-ray, fluorescence and histomorphometric analyses.
